Navigating Wrongful Termination in Pasadena Following Complaints

Facing dismissal in Pasadena after filing a grievance can be a deeply stressful experience. State law safeguards employees from unjust removal when it's stemming from actions they've taken to raise workplace problems. This commonly arises when an employee brings concerns about discrimination and subsequently encounters adverse action, including job loss. Understanding your entitlements is vital. Consider these points:

  • Documentation: Thoroughly maintain all evidence related to the grievance and your subsequent dismissal.
  • Legal Counsel: Consulting a experienced employment attorney in Pasadena is highly recommended.
  • Timelines: Be mindful of applicable deadlines for filing a unjust firing claim.
